We are designing the Proton Therapy Unit of La Paz Hospital in Madrid

The Hospital Universitario La Paz in Madrid will soon have an innovative proton therapy unit. We are leading the project providing architectural and engineering services, detailed design and construction management.

As part of this project, we will be responsible for safety analysis studies and the necessary documentation in support of the CSN safety approval process for the new IBA Proteus One unit.

This unit is part of the donation made by the Amancio Ortega Foundation to help bring Proton Therapy to Spain. This endeavor is part of Sustainable Development Goal 3: Health and Wellness, and its inclusion will have a direct impact on the quality of life of users of the public health system.

IDOM has experience in the design and construction of 4 other proton therapy centers: Donostia University Hospital, Marqués de Valdecilla University Hospital Proton Therapy Center in Santander, Hadron Therapy and Research Center at the International University of Kutaisi in Georgia, and Quirón Salud Proton Therapy Center in Pozuelo, Madrid, which was the first proton therapy oncology treatment center built in Spain.

The multidisciplinary nature of our team allows the integration of all the technical disciplines involved, which is particularly suitable for this type of projects, which are of great technical complexity and very high demands in terms of rigor and precision.
